Description
Sodium myristate is a fatty acid salt primarily used as a surfactant, emulsifier, and detergent.
SynonymsSodium myristate
Chemical Properties
Molecular Weight250.35
FormulaC14H27NaO2
Cas No.822-12-8
SmilesO=C(CCCCCCCCCCCCC)[O-].[Na+]
Storage & Solubility Information
Storagekeep away from moisture | Powder: -20°C for 3 years | In solvent: -80°C for 1 year
Solubility Information
DMSO: < 1 mg/mL (insoluble)
H2O: 4.50 mg/mL (17.97 mM), Sonication is recommended.
Ethanol: 3.20 mg/mL (12.78 mM), Sonication is recommended.
